Kamon Wharf

Unbeatable dining, shopping, and scenic walks at this seaside mall.

Last update :

Opened in 2002 in the Karato area of Shimonoseki Port, Kamon Wharf is the seaside mall where you can delight in Shimonoseki famed fugu dishes, sushi, seafood bowls, and other tastes from the Kanmon Straits, along with shops selling local specialties and souvenirs. The area is known to draw a crowd thanks to the Karato Market and its fresh seafood that’s open to the general public to come and shop, while the Kaikyo Kan aquarium and its 550 some species inside continues to stir up an unprecedented level of buzz around Moji Port.

Kamon Wharf, Karato Market and Kaikyo Kan are all connected by the “boardwalk” wooden deck. The boardwark is a popular lane offering daytime views of the red and white "Lovers' Lighthouse", the Kanmon Bridge directly in front and a romantic nightscape after dark. For popular photo spots, there’s even a pufferfish sculpture in front of Kamon Wharf with a heart mark hidden in the body design.

Q

Is parking available?

A

Yes, there are 104 spaces available. The first 30 minutes are completely free, then 120 yen per 30 minutes.

Q

Are coin lockers available?

A

Yes, available from 10:00am to 5:00pm, but with a phone call, they can be used until 8:00pm.
